Subject going into a hypnotic trance, 1891. An Irish physician using the pseudonym Dr Stanley gave a demonstration of hypnosis using the methods of French neurologist Jean Martin Charcot (1825-1893). The event was held at the Hotel Metropole, London, and was under the auspices of members of the medical profession. From The Illustrated London News. (London, 1891)
